History
A concise historical narrative of NAICS Code 423120-46 covering global milestones and recent developments within the United States.
- The history of the Speedometers (Wholesale) industry dates back to the early 1900s when the first speedometers were invented. The first speedometers were mechanical and used a cable to connect the speedometer to the transmission. In the 1920s, the first electric speedometers were introduced, which were more accurate and reliable than their mechanical counterparts. In the 1950s, electronic speedometers were developed, which used a magnetic sensor to measure the speed of the vehicle. In recent years, the industry has seen advancements in digital speedometers, which provide more accurate readings and can be customized to display additional information such as fuel consumption and engine temperature. Material
Analog Speedometers: These traditional speedometers utilize a needle and dial to display speed, providing drivers with a straightforward and reliable means of monitoring their vehicle's speed. Commonly used in older vehicle models, they are favored for their simplicity and ease of use.
Digital Speedometers: Digital speedometers feature electronic displays that provide precise speed readings, often including additional features such as trip meters and average speed calculations. These are widely used in modern vehicles for their accuracy and advanced functionalities.
GPS Speedometers: Utilizing satellite technology, GPS speedometers offer real-time speed tracking and can provide navigation assistance. They are particularly popular among fleet operators and long-distance travelers for their multifunctional capabilities.
Speedometer Adapters: Adapters are used to connect speedometers to different types of transmissions, ensuring compatibility across various vehicle models. They are essential for automotive technicians when retrofitting or replacing speedometers.
Speedometer Cables: These cables connect the speedometer to the vehicle's transmission, transmitting speed data. They are crucial for the proper functioning of mechanical speedometers and are commonly replaced during vehicle maintenance.
Speedometer Calibration Tools: These tools are essential for ensuring speedometers provide accurate readings. Calibration tools are used by automotive technicians to adjust speedometers, ensuring compliance with legal standards and enhancing vehicle safety.
Speedometer Clusters: Speedometer clusters integrate multiple gauges, including speedometers, tachometers, and fuel gauges, into a single unit. These are essential for vehicle dashboards, providing drivers with comprehensive information about their vehicle's performance.
Speedometer Faceplates: Customizable faceplates allow vehicle owners to personalize the appearance of their speedometers. These are often used in aftermarket modifications to enhance the visual appeal of vehicle dashboards.
Speedometer Mounting Brackets: These brackets are used to securely install speedometers in vehicles, ensuring they are positioned for optimal visibility. They are important for both aesthetic and functional purposes in vehicle interiors.
Speedometer Repair Kits: These kits contain various components needed to repair malfunctioning speedometers, including gears, cables, and sensors. They are commonly purchased by automotive repair shops to facilitate quick and efficient repairs.
Speedometer Sensors: Speedometer sensors detect the vehicle's speed and relay this information to the speedometer. These electronic components are vital for modern vehicles, ensuring accurate speed readings and are frequently used in repairs and replacements.
Speedometer Software Calibration Tools: Software tools are used to calibrate digital speedometers, allowing technicians to adjust settings for accuracy. These tools are essential in modern automotive repair shops for maintaining vehicle performance.
Speedometer Testing Equipment: This equipment is used to test the accuracy and functionality of speedometers, ensuring they meet safety standards. Automotive service centers frequently utilize these tools to verify speedometer performance during inspections.
Speedometer Wiring Harnesses: Wiring harnesses are essential for connecting speedometers to the vehicle's electrical system, ensuring proper functionality. They are commonly used in vehicle repairs and upgrades to maintain electrical integrity.
Wireless Speedometers: These innovative speedometers use wireless technology to communicate with vehicle systems, eliminating the need for physical connections. They are increasingly popular in custom vehicle builds and modifications for their ease of installation.
